Automating blood cell washing applications
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aA new automated, high-performance cell washer has been specifically designed to enable precise, thorough, reproducible and rapid blood cell washing of up to 24 tubes in a three-minute run. Fully automated, the Thermo Scientific CW3 Cell Washer has been uniquely engineered to combine the benefits of efficient performance with user-friendly design and safe operation. Users can select one of the pre-set programs that have been designed to run in automatic mode, accelerate blood cell washing cycles and achieve significant time savings, while allowing for maximum ease of use and sample safety. Effective blood cell washing is extremely important in the removal of plasma and unwanted antibodies to ensure that patients will not be affected by adverse health effects and that blood-transfused products will retain all of their beneficial attributes. The CW3 Cell Washer has been designed to achieve optimal corpuscle dryness by allowing users to pre-set the desired decanting speed. At the same time, corpuscle washing is improved via the optional overfl ow method. For washing, tubes swing at a fixed positive angle to sediment cells rapidly at the bottom of the tube, whereas when decanting, the rotor holds tubes at a slightly negative angle and the saline is decanted centrifugally. The result is optimized pelleting performance. Furthermore, the flexibility to use 12- or 24-place rotors and standardized, repeatable procedures enables the instrument to adapt to the processes and protocols already in place within the lab. Built with sample safety in mind, the compact CW3 Cell Washer features an automatic alert mechanism that informs users about low or disrupted saline levels and when a run is complete. A view port on top of the unit facilitates quick calibration, while the saline distributor is mounted directly on top of the rotor to reduce the risk of cross-contamination. The new washer is also equipped with tube racks bearing red and blue number labelling for easy sample balancing. In addition, when closed-monitoring of the washing process is required, the system can be operated manually to allow for cells that need to be washed step-by-step. As a low maintenance instrument, the CW3 Cell Washer includes easy-to-change pump tubing and an easy-toremove catch basin, rotor and rotating bowl.

Advanced panel for respiratory tract infection testing
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aThe newly CE marked FilmArray Respiratory Panel 2 plus (RP2plus) tests for 22 pathogens (18 viruses and 4 bacteria) responsible for respiratory tract infections. It advances the existing FilmArray Respiratory Panel (RP) by reducing the assay time from about an hour to less than 45 minutes, improving overall sensitivity, and updating several assays. FilmArray RP2plus also includes 2 additional pathogens: Bordetella parapertussis, one of the causative agents of pertussis or whooping cough, a highly infectious bacterial disease, and Middle East Respiratory Syndrome coronavirus (MERS-CoV). According to the WHO, the recent MERS-CoV outbreak in the Republic of Korea demonstrated a great potential for widespread transmission and severe disruption both to the health system and to society. The MERS-CoV case fatality rate is approximately 36%. Bordetella parapertussis infections represent a significant cause of whooping cough which is oft en missed because of a clinical presentation largely indistinguishable from other viral infections and of lack of reliable diagnostic tests. The FilmArray RP2plus is available for use on the FilmArray 2.0 and FilmArray Torch systems and will be commercially available in the countries that recognize CE marking by mid-June 2017.

High-sensitivity Troponin I IVD assay
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aThe new high-sensitivity troponin I (TNIH) in vitro diagnostics assay is designed to aid in diagnosing acute myocardial infarctions (AMI) through the quantitative measurement of cardiac troponin I in serum or plasma. High-sensitivity troponin plays a critical role in the timely diagnosis of AMI, or heart attacks. The presence of cardiac troponin is specific to heart muscle death. The detection of circulating troponins has long been recognized as the gold standard for the diagnosis of AMI in patients who present with chest pain in the emergency room. Compared to traditional troponin assays, the Siemens Healthineers TNIH assay is able to detect lower levels of troponin and smaller changes to a patient’s troponin levels, which may be an early indication of AMI. This design affords clinicians greater confidence in patient results at the low end of the assay range by delivering precision that provides the ability to measure slight, yet critical, changes between serial troponin I values. Precision at the low end is important to minimize analytic variation that could confuse a clinician’s assessment of a clinically significant change. With this data in hand, clinicians have the ability to more quickly diagnose and treat patients with suspected AMI, in some cases in as little as one to three hours. The TNIH assay meets current European Society of Cardiology guideline recommendations. Further, clinical study data involving approximately 2,500 patients at different time points from more than 30 trial sites in the United States and Europe demonstrate the TNIH assay’s efficiency. The TNIH assay is available for use on the ADVIA Centaur XPT and ADVIA Centaur XP systems, the company’s high efficiency laboratory analysers. The company also plans to make the high-sensitivity troponin I assays available on its other testing systems, including the Dimension Vista, Dimension EXL and Atellica IM analyser.

Chemistry analyser
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aThe new DxC 700 AU chemistry analyser brings together the advanced capabilities of two successful Beckman Coulter products – the simple intuitive design of the DxC analyser and the robust throughput and workhorse capabilities of the AU analyser – into one standardized platform designed to meet the needs of mid- to high-volume clinical laboratories. Additionally, by gaining further input from the clinical laboratory professionals, who are under pressure daily to produce faster results and manage resources more efficiently, additional features and benefits were identified and designed into the product. The DxC 700 AU chemistry analyser reduces the number of test-processing steps by 30%, streamlining workflow for laboratory professionals. The reduction in steps is the result of powerful operating software, an all-new design and an intuitive user-interface that allow operators to spend less time on daily tasks and more time producing the quality results that empower better decision-making for better patient care. The new software is easy to learn and simple to operate with very little experience. The ability to load reagents ‘on-the-fly,’ while the instrument is running, saves time and minimizes disruption to workflow. Along with its efficiency, the DxC 700 AU analyser reduces total cost of ownership by using fewer consumables compared to other industry same-class systems. Additionally, the system uses concentrated reagents, longlasting ion-selective electrodes (ISEs), and non-disposable cuvettes to help laboratory specialists achieve financial goals and manage resources. The system is further designed for time- and cost-savings superior uptime through the Beckman Coulter “3 & 60” concept. The “3 & 60” concept gives laboratory staff the ability to change out replacement parts in three steps, within 60 seconds, with no tools. The DxC 700 AU analyser is part of Beckman Coulter’s Total Laboratory Solution, featuring a broader comprehensive portfolio that provides the flexibility to tailor systems based on a laboratory’s volume and space needs. Customers have access to an array of efficient solutions, including: the Power Link system, which connects small-footprint automation with chemistry and immunoassay analysers; the Power Express, a multi-discipline, tracked-based automation solution; and, Remisol or Command Central, both of which offer robust information data management capabilities. The DxC 700 AU system is currently available in the U.S. and will become available in other regions throughout the world in 2017.

Auto loading hematology system
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aProviding full walk-away capability to small and mid-size laboratories, the new Yumizen H550 has been designed to meet the challenging laboratories requirements of providing a cost-effective solution based on ‘state of art’ hematology diagnosis combined with the user-friendly operation. The Yumizen H550 is a compact 6-Diff hematology analyser with an auto sampling system which aims at providing a full walk-away capability to a variety of clinical environments: hospitals, satellite labs, emergency care, small independent labs as well as doctors’ offices. With safe sample management, the Yumizen H550 is able to deliver a one hour hands-off operation with 40 samples in racks. Additional benefits include: continuous loading, automatic sample mixing, positive identification of samples and a manual mode for STAT samples for both open and closed tubes. The latter will manage emergency and pediatrics demands for a variety of samples types. Based on the innovative ‘3 reagent use’ technology with low consumption, the Yumizen H550 hematology system incorporates enhanced features with high added value for laboratories in terms of data management and traceability standards: flexible connectivity with both ASTM and HL7 communication standards and overlapping quality controls.

ß-Hydroxybutyrate ready-to-use reagent
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aDiaSys offers an improved, liquid-stable and ready-to-use reagent for common clinical chemistry analysers. For the determination of ß-hydroxybutyrate (ß-HBUT) serum and plasma samples can be used. ß-HBUT is an important marker to detect di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A), a potentially life-threatening complication in diabetes mellitus, which can lead to coma or even death. The new ß-Hydroxybutyrate 21 FS offers a wide measuring range which ensures few sample repeats and therefore is time- and cost-saving. Interferences to endogenous and exogenous substances were minimized and calibration and on-board stability were prolonged to 12 weeks. The new ß-Hydroxybutyrate 21 FS is robust and provides accurate and highly reproducible results.

ToRCH ELISA assays
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aDIAsource ImmunoAssays has announced the CE-IVD certification of 6 parameters of the ToRCH panel: Toxoplasma IgG Elisa # KAPDTOXOG; Toxoplasma IgM Elisa # KAPDTOXOM; CMV IgG Elisa # KAPDCMVG; CMV IgM Elisa # KAPDCMVM; Rubella IgG Elisa # KAPDRUBG; Rubella IgM Elisa # KAPDRUBM. The new assays have a common protocol (only 10µl of sample required) which allows their easy adaptation to most of the common automated ELISA platforms e.g. Stratec Gemini. The “IgG Elisa” are quantitative assays and include one control. The “IgM Elisa” are based on the IgM µ-capture technique, are qualitative assays and include three controls. Moreover, their high diagnostics specificity and sensitivity allow respectively the accurate detection of acute infection and the reduction of false positive cases. Lastly, the colour coded kit reagents offer easy recognition in a manual setting.

Assays for the reliable determination of metanephrines in plasma
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aChromsystems launched MassChrom Metanephrines in Plasma new CE-IVD assays for the efficient quantification of metanephrine, normetanephrine and 3-methoxytyramine by LC-MS/MS. The kits are available in two configurations, either with sample clean up columns or 96 SPE well plates. The assays encompass all required components and enable a simple and fast sample preparation in just a few steps. The analytes are chromatographically separated, avoiding co-elution and minimizing the risk of interferences. Stable isotope-labelled internal standards for every single analyte ensure a reproducible and reliable quantification. The 6PLUS1 Multilevel Calibrator Set and MassCheck controls are based on human plasma to minimize matrix-induced differences. MassChrom Metanephrines in Plasma complement the full range of CE-IVD assays from Chromsystems for the determination of biogenic amines. These include assays for HPLC and LC-MS/MS and in the plasma and urine matrices. Laboratories with higher sample throughput can also rely on the company’s automated systems.

New high-range hematology system
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aIn order to meet the needs of the mid-high size laboratories segment, HORIBA Medical has developed a new high range solution in hematology : the HELO Solution (HELO : HORIBA Evolutive Laboratory Organisation). Based on the combination of innovative and proven technologies, it is perfectly suited to laboratories whose throughput extends from 300 to 20,000 tubes per day. The analysers Yumizen H2500 / H1500 and SPS (slide stainer) are the new analytical cores of this system. The overall results (patients and quality controls) produced by the instruments are analyzed, checked and validated by the Yumizen P8000, a new generation of specialized hematology validation station (Middleware). This solution allows laboratories organized in multi-sites to centralize data management, optimize automatic validation of results (customizable rules engine), while controlling productivity, thanks to real-time performance indicators (status connection, maintenance, TAT, manual validation, etc.). The management of reagents and waste has been optimized and is an integral part of the HELO Solution. In addition, the company’s system of connected analytical devices and high throughput tube conveyer, the Yumizen T6000 connection automation system, allows the link of all the analysers. Based on several patents, the Yumizen T6000 system optimizes the flow of tubes, in order to offer the best possible TAT. It offers 4 types of configuration: linear to replace identical configurations; angle to adapt the configuration of your laboratory; workcell to maximize personnel efficiency and island to minimize the floor area. Combined with the QAP programme (Quality Assurance Programme) the HELO Solution is in full compliance with ISO 15189.

New range of hematology analysers
, /in Product News /by 3wmediaWith a genuine throughput of 120 tests per hour for CBC including differential and nucleated RBCs, the Yumizen H2500 and Yumizen H1500 are able to absorb the workflow of laboratories with high activity. Both analysers are equipped with a three-dimensional count capable of combining the measurements of cellular complexity, volume and distribution for each of the leukocyte subpopulations. In order to manage leucopenic, thrombocytopenic and anemic samples, an integrated ‘low value’ cycle allows automatic readjustment of the counting constants. In addition, a new platelet determination system operates via two methods, impedance and optical extinction in separate channels. Also included is the company’s newest middleware, the Yumizen P8000, which allows laboratories to centralize data management and optimize automatic validation of results (customizable rules engine), while controlling productivity and real-time performance (connection status, maintenance, TAT, manual validation …). The Yumizen SPS can be optionally added to the Yumizen H2500 and allows fully automatic slide-making at a rate of 120 slides per hour. The Yumizen H2500 / H1500 + Yumizen SPS module are available as standalone units or combined in the HELO Solution (HELO = HORIBA Evolutive Laboratory Organization) allowing several instruments to be connected to the Yumizen T6000 high-speed tube conveyor.
